William A. “Tony” Mahaney, 69, Bristow
William A. “Tony” Mahaney, 69, of Bristow, passed away at 2:31 a.m. on July 22, 2026, at Deaconess Memorial Medical Center in Jasper.

He was born on January 12, 1957, in Owensboro, Kentucky. He was united in marriage to Linda Prueher on April 22, 1978, in Troy, Indiana.
Tony was a devoted University of Kentucky Wildcats basketball fan and rarely missed cheering on his team. He also enjoyed listening to K-LOVE Radio, where he found encouragement and inspiration through Christian music. Above all, Tony cherished his family and found his greatest joy in spending time with his children, grandchildren, and great-grandchildren.
He was preceded in death by his mother, Francis Mahaney; one brother, Walter “Bud” Mahaney; one brother-in-law, Phil Simpson; and a great-granddaughter, Maeson Kellems.
He is survived by his wife, Linda Mahaney of Bristow; three children, Stacy (Stacy) Mahaney of Gentryville, Stephanie (Rob) Britton of Evansville and Sam Mahaney of Evansville; four siblings, Sue Simpson, James Mahaney, Dwayne Mahaney and Kevin (Charlene) Mahaney; one sister-in-law, Linda Mahaney; six grandchildren, Annie (Tim), Hannah, James (Hope) and Delilah Paris, Cailee and Grayson Britton; four great-grandchildren, Phoenix and Oliver Kellems, Enzo Efaw and Hudson Paris; and by several nieces and nephews.
